MySQL存入正整数
前言
MySQL是一种流行的开源关系型数据库管理系统,它使用SQL作为查询语言。在实际应用中,我们经常需要将正整数存储到MySQL数据库中。本文将介绍如何在MySQL中存储和处理正整数,并提供相应的代码示例。
数据类型选择
在MySQL中,可以使用多种数据类型来存储正整数,常见的有INT、BIGINT和VARCHAR。选择合适的数据类型是非常重要的,它不仅影响存储空间的占用,还会影响查询和计算的性能。
- INT:用于存储较小范围的正整数,占用4个字节的存储空间,范围为-2147483648到2147483647。
- BIGINT:用于存储较大范围的正整数,占用8个字节的存储空间,范围为-9223372036854775808到9223372036854775807。
- VARCHAR:用于存储可变长度的正整数,占用的存储空间根据实际数字长度而定。
根据实际需求选择合适的数据类型,以节省存储空间并提高数据读写的效率。
创建表格
在MySQL中存储数据之前,需要先创建相应的表格。下面的代码示例展示了如何创建一个名为numbers
的表格,用于存储正整数。
CREATE TABLE numbers (
id INT PRIMARY KEY AUTO_INCREMENT,
value INT
);
上述代码创建了一个具有两个列的表格。id
列用于唯一标识每个记录,类型为INT,并设置为自动递增。value
列用于存储正整数的值,类型同样为INT。
插入数据
当表格创建完成后,可以向其中插入正整数数据。下面的代码示例展示了如何向numbers
表格中插入正整数数据。
INSERT INTO numbers (value) VALUES (123);
INSERT INTO numbers (value) VALUES (456);
INSERT INTO numbers (value) VALUES (789);
上述代码使用INSERT语句将三个正整数分别插入到numbers
表格的value
列中。
查询数据
在MySQL中,可以使用SELECT语句来查询存储在表格中的正整数数据。下面的代码示例展示了如何查询numbers
表格中的正整数数据。
SELECT * FROM numbers;
上述代码使用SELECT *语句查询numbers
表格中的所有数据。可以通过添加WHERE子句来实现更精确的查询。
更新数据
如果需要更新存储在表格中的正整数数据,可以使用UPDATE语句。下面的代码示例展示了如何更新numbers
表格中的正整数数据。
UPDATE numbers SET value = 999 WHERE id = 2;
上述代码使用UPDATE语句将numbers
表格中id为2的记录的value值更新为999。
删除数据
如果需要删除存储在表格中的正整数数据,可以使用DELETE语句。下面的代码示例展示了如何删除numbers
表格中的正整数数据。
DELETE FROM numbers WHERE id = 3;
上述代码使用DELETE语句删除numbers
表格中id为3的记录。
总结
通过本文的介绍,我们了解了在MySQL中存储正整数的方法。首先,选择合适的数据类型,根据实际需求确定使用INT、BIGINT还是VARCHAR。然后,创建相应的表格,并使用INSERT语句插入正整数数据。最后,可以使用SELECT、UPDATE和DELETE语句对存储的正整数数据进行查询、更新和删除操作。
MySQL是一个功能强大的数据库管理系统,掌握其中的存储和处理数据的方法对于开发和维护应用程序非常重要。希望本文对读者能够有所帮助。
旅行图
下图展示了在MySQL中存储正整数的过程。
journey
title MySQL存储